Frequently asked questions

How is braking distance calculated?

Braking distance = v squared / (2 x mu x g), where v is speed in m/s, mu is the grip coefficient and g is 9.81. We add the thinking distance (speed x reaction time) for the total stopping distance.

Why does stopping distance quadruple with speed?

Braking distance grows with the square of speed, so doubling your speed roughly quadruples the distance needed to stop - a key reason small speed increases matter so much.

How much does wet road add?

Grip can drop from about 1.0 dry to 0.5 wet, which doubles the braking distance. Ice can cut grip to 0.1-0.2, multiplying it several times over.
